History & Fun Facts

  • Its first president was Daniel McBride Graham, who held the office from 1844 to 1848.
  • Edmund Burke Fairfield assumed the school's presidency in 1848, and in 1850, the college was chartered to confer degrees.
  • Outgrowing its space by 1853, the school moved to Hillsdale, Michigan, in part to have access to the railroad that served the city.
  • Construction was completed and the school reopened as Hillsdale College in 1855.
  • Fairfield led Hillsdale for 25 years, from 1848 to 1869.
